Understanding Instant Coffee

Before diving into the methods and techniques, let’s clarify what instant coffee is. Instant coffee, also known as soluble coffee, is a product made from brewed coffee that has been dried, allowing it to dissolve quickly in hot water. This process gives instant coffee its characteristic convenience but can sometimes compromise its flavor profile.

Types of Instant Coffee

There are two primary types of instant coffee:

  • Freeze-Dried Coffee: This method retains more of the original coffee flavor and aroma, resulting in a better-tasting cup.
  • Spray-Dried Coffee: Typically less expensive, this type may have a less vibrant taste but is still a practical choice for quick brewing.

By choosing the right type, you can significantly enhance your instant coffee experience.

Measuring Your Ingredients

Precision in measurement can transform your coffee experience. As a general rule, use:

Coffee Type Water Amount Instant Coffee Amount
Light Brew 8 oz (240 ml) 1 – 2 tsp
Medium Brew 8 oz (240 ml) 2 – 3 tsp
Strong Brew 8 oz (240 ml) 3 – 4 tsp

Tailoring these amounts allows you to control the strength and flavor of your coffee.

Steps to Prepare Instant Coffee

Now that you have your ingredients and measurements ready, follow these steps for an incredible cup of instant coffee.

Step 1: Boil Water

Start by bringing water to a boil using a kettle or stovetop. Keep in mind that using overly boiling water can scorch the coffee and affect its flavor negatively. Once boiled, remove the water from heat and let it cool slightly for no more than 30 seconds.

Step 2: Measure Instant Coffee

Depending on your desired brew strength, add the measured amount of instant coffee into your cup. For a stronger flavor, lean towards the higher end of the recommended range.

Step 3: Pour Water Over Coffee

Carefully pour the hot water over the coffee granules. For best results, pour slowly to allow the granules to dissolve evenly.

Step 4: Stir Well

Utilize your spoon to stir the mixture for about 30 seconds or until all the coffee granules have dissolved completely. This step is crucial for achieving a smooth and rich flavor.

What is the ideal water temperature for preparing instant coffee?

The ideal water temperature for preparing instant coffee typically ranges between 190°F to 205°F (88°C to 96°C). Using water that is too hot can scorch the coffee granules or powder, resulting in a bitter taste. Conversely, water that is not hot enough may not fully dissolve the instant coffee, leading to a weak flavor and an unpleasant experience. To achieve the best flavor, it’s essential to heat the water appropriately before mixing it with the coffee.

Using a thermometer can help measure the water temperature accurately, but if you don’t have one, a simple guideline is to let boiling water sit for about 30 seconds before adding the instant coffee. This approach ensures your water is hot without being overly so, providing a better extraction of flavors and aromas.

How should I store instant coffee for optimal freshness?

To maintain optimal freshness, instant coffee should be stored in an airtight container away from light, heat, and moisture. A cool, dark pantry or cupboard is an ideal location for storage. Avoid leaving it in the original packaging if it’s a resealable bag; transferring it to a more secure container will help minimize exposure to air, which can cause the coffee to lose its flavor over time.

It’s also best to keep instant coffee away from strong odors, as coffee is highly absorbent and can pick up smells from its surroundings. By following proper storage techniques, you can enjoy your instant coffee at the peak of its flavor for an extended period, making your daily cup all the more enjoyable.
